Cultivating Green Entrepreneurship in Africa: A Catalyst for Sustainable Development



Africa's vast potential for economic growth and environmental sustainability is intrinsically linked to the flourishing of green entrepreneurship. This paper argues that empowering indigenous innovators is paramount to unlocking this potential, driving significant transformative change across the continent. A multi-faceted strategy, incorporating principles of self-reliance, investment in human capital, fostering collaborative networks, and leveraging sustainable technologies, is crucial for achieving this objective. We will explore these key elements through the lens of relevant economic and sustainability theories.



Investing in Human Capital: A Foundation for Green Innovation


The human capital theory posits that investments in education and skills development directly translate into increased productivity and economic growth. In the context of green entrepreneurship, this translates to a strategic investment in educational programs that equip future generations with the requisite skills to thrive in a sustainable economy. This includes not only technical expertise in renewable energy, sustainable agriculture, and eco-friendly manufacturing, but also the cultivation of entrepreneurial mindsets characterized by innovation, critical thinking, and a strong understanding of market dynamics. This approach directly addresses the lack of skilled labor often cited as a barrier to economic advancement in many African nations, fostering a virtuous cycle of innovation and growth as predicted by endogenous growth theory.




Leveraging Sustainable Technologies: A Dual Path to Prosperity


The adoption of green technologies presents a unique opportunity for simultaneous environmental and economic advancement. Investing in renewable energy infrastructure (solar, wind, hydro), sustainable agricultural practices (precision agriculture, water-efficient irrigation), and eco-friendly manufacturing processes creates new market niches, generates employment, and strengthens local economies. This aligns with the Porter Hypothesis, suggesting that stringent environmental regulations can stimulate innovation and foster a competitive advantage. By embracing sustainable technologies, African nations can not only mitigate environmental challenges but also position themselves as global leaders in the burgeoning green economy.




Fostering Self-Reliance through Entrepreneurial Ecosystems


Economic independence is crucial for sustainable development. Nurturing local entrepreneurship through the creation of robust entrepreneurial ecosystems is critical. This involves establishing supportive policy environments, providing access to finance (microfinance initiatives, venture capital), and fostering mentorship programs. The concept of "clustering," where businesses in related industries locate geographically close to each other, facilitates knowledge sharing and collaboration, leading to increased innovation and productivity. Such an approach aligns with the principles of regional economic development, fostering community ownership and driving sustainable growth from within.




Pan-African Collaboration: Harnessing Synergies for Sustainable Growth


Collaborative networks are essential for overcoming geographical and institutional barriers hindering progress. Sharing resources, knowledge, and best practices across national borders fosters a more resilient entrepreneurial ecosystem. This collaborative approach draws from the network theory, which highlights the importance of strong social connections and information flows for economic development. By breaking down these barriers, African nations can collectively address challenges more effectively, leverage economies of scale, and seize opportunities more efficiently, leading to a more robust and integrated green economy across the continent.




Lessons from Global Best Practices and Case Studies


Analyzing successful case studies of green entrepreneurship globallyโ€”such as the transformative impact of Tesla's electric vehicle technology or the success of community-based renewable energy projects in developing nationsโ€”provides valuable insights and adaptable models. These examples highlight the power of disruptive innovation, strategic partnerships, and community engagement in achieving sustainability goals. By learning from these experiences, African entrepreneurs can navigate challenges more effectively and adopt successful strategies tailored to their specific contexts.




Conclusions and Recommendations


Promoting green entrepreneurship in Africa is not merely aspirational; it is a strategic imperative for sustainable development. This requires a holistic approach that encompasses investments in human capital, leveraging sustainable technologies, fostering self-reliance through robust entrepreneurial ecosystems, and strengthening pan-African collaboration. By applying relevant economic theories, such as human capital theory, endogenous growth theory, the Porter Hypothesis, and network theory, and by drawing lessons from global best practices, African nations can create a self-reliant and sustainable future. Further research should focus on developing tailored policy interventions, specifically designed to support green entrepreneurs in diverse African contexts, while also examining the long-term economic and social impacts of green initiatives.
